Default 05 neon dies on highway code p0340

So I have an '05 neon that died on the highway about a month ago. There were 3 codes showing, I've resolved 2 of them. An oil pressure sensor and camshaft position sensor were the first 2. The last one is p0340, which is related to the crankshaft position sensor. so I tried replacing that with an off brand sensor, with no luck. So I replaced that one with an o.e.m. sensor and still no luck. I can't get the car to start, but can turn the key and sounds like its cranking but just wont start. Anyone have any other ideas? no signal to PCM? damaged wiring? faulty PCM? I've had to replace a bunch of sensors on this car over the last 2 years or so, and some of the same ones multiple times. Don't know if that's an indication of something else going on as well. Any insight would be appreciated.
